2014-12-05 10:49 GMT+01:00 Martin Vonwald <[email protected]>: > In my opinion the "gas station" is not the building but the whole area. > Also the address belongs to the whole area and that's the way I tag gas > stations: > > - Draw an area to cover the complete gas station and put amenity=fuel > together with additional tags like the address on it. In my region it is > usually quite clear on an aerial image where the station starts and where > it ends (some kind of fence, barrier, whatever, ...). > - Draw the roads (highway=service) and buildings (building=yes resp. > building=roof + layer=1) > - Additional attributes like amenity=car_wash, amenity=parking, > shop=convenience.... go to there actual position, i.e. if there is a > convenience store in one of the buildings I add the tag there. > - No need to provide the address more than once: the address belongs > to everything within the area tagged with amenity=fuel > >
+1, the same around here. There is also an attribute "shop=yes" that some people add to the amenity=fuel object to say that it's a gas station with a shop. Cheers, Martin
